Notification System Architecture
WebSocket-driven, type- and priority-aware notifications for the @robonen monorepo.
Status: design proposal (not yet implemented). Synthesized from a multi-agent design pass and adversarially verified against the real repo APIs. The "Verified facts" call-outs below are confirmed against source; the corrections from review are already folded into the code in this document.
0. Context — what already exists
The presentation layer already exists: a full sonner-style headless toast primitive lives at
vue/primitives/src/toast/ — ToastProvider, ToastRoot,
ToastViewport, ToastTitle/Description/Action/Close/Announce/Portal, with per-toast auto-dismiss
(pause/resume RAF timer), swipe-to-dismiss, teleport-to-viewport, a11y live-region announce,
collection-based stacking, and controlled/uncontrolled v-model:open. We drive it, we do not
fork it.

Server contract this layer depends on (new, server-side, not part of any existing repo API): (1) strictly-monotonic per-session server-assigned
seq; (2) onResumeFrame{cursor}the server replays every frame withseq > cursor; (3) a reconciliation endpoint/command to re-request a permanently-lost[from, to]range flushed by the gap-timeout; (4) action commands are idempotent, keyed byclientToken, and the server echoes that token inAckFrame.ref.

4.3 Connection lifecycle — createAsyncMachine
Verified ordering inside send(): guard → action → exit → set currentState → entry, all awaited;
one action per transition, one entry/exit per state; the initial state's entry does not auto-run
on construction. NET_OFFLINE/NET_ONLINE are first-class events that pause/resume retry scheduling
instead of burning the attempt counter.

backoff.ts is a bespoke standalone function (it does not call stdlib retry(), which loops
attempts internally and cannot drive an event-driven, network-gated, machine-scheduled reconnect). It
borrows only the shape of a delay: (n) => number function:
export function backoffDelay(attempt: number, o: { base?: number; cap?: number; jitter?: boolean } = {}): number {
const base = o.base ?? 500, cap = o.cap ?? 30_000;
const raw = Math.min(cap, base * 2 ** attempt);
return o.jitter === false ? raw : raw * (0.5 + Math.random() * 0.5); // full jitter
}
// scheduleRetry(attempt): a no-op while !isOnline(); else setTimeout(backoffDelay(attempt)) -> machine.send('RETRY').
4.4 Heartbeat / zombie detection
heartbeatPlugin arms a watchdog whenever connected. Any inbound frame (pong or data) clears
it; on fire → machine.send('DROPPED'). This is the only reliable TCP-half-open detector. Conservative
configurable defaults (ping 20s / watchdog 10s).
4.5 Ordering / dedup / resume
// core/realtime/src/lru.ts — bounded dedup set (prevents an unbounded memory leak over a long session)
export class LruSet {
private map = new Map<string, true>();
constructor(private max = 4096) {}
has(k: string) { return this.map.has(k); }
add(k: string) {
if (this.map.has(k)) this.map.delete(k); // bump to MRU
this.map.set(k, true);
if (this.map.size > this.max) this.map.delete(this.map.keys().next().value!); // evict LRU
}
}
// core/realtime/src/reorder.ts
export function createReorderBuffer(opts: { gapTimeoutMs?: number; onReconcile?: (from: number, to: number) => void }) {
const buffer = new Deque<NotificationFrame>([], { maxSize: 1024 }); // out-of-order hold (causal-hold; ref: crdt replica.ts)
const seen = new LruSet(8192); // BOUNDED dedup-by-id
let lastSeq = 0;
let cursor: string | undefined; // = String(lastSeq), persisted
function accept(f: NotificationFrame): NotificationFrame[] {
if (seen.has(f.id) || f.seq <= lastSeq) return []; // duplicate / replay -> drop (idempotent at-least-once)
seen.add(f.id);
if (f.seq === lastSeq + 1) {
const out = [f]; lastSeq = f.seq; cursor = String(lastSeq); // CONTIGUOUS — advance cursor ONLY here
let next: NotificationFrame | undefined;
while ((next = takeSeq(buffer, lastSeq + 1))) { out.push(next); lastSeq = next.seq; cursor = String(lastSeq); }
return out;
}
putBySeq(buffer, f); // gap: hold, DO NOT advance cursor
armGapTimeout(() => opts.onReconcile?.(lastSeq + 1, f.seq - 1)); // permanent-loss -> deliver-with-gap + server reconcile
return [];
}
return { accept, get cursor() { return cursor; }, hydrate(c?: string) { if (c) { lastSeq = Number(c); cursor = c; } } };
}
Resume: ResumeFrame{cursor} is sent on every connected.entry; the server replays seq > cursor.
resumePlugin persists the cursor via useStorage so it survives a full reload. A scalar suffices —
a single-writer per-user stream collapses the version-vector to one entry (O(1) resume, small wire).

mergeLattice is the convergence rule for concurrent two-tab edits:
const LIFECYCLE_RANK: Record<NotificationLifecycle, number> = { received:0, queued:1, toasted:2, read:3, dismissed:4, archived:5, expired:6 };
function mergeLattice(local: Notification, remote: Notification): void {
if (LIFECYCLE_RANK[remote.lifecycle] > LIFECYCLE_RANK[local.lifecycle]) local.lifecycle = remote.lifecycle; // max over lattice
local.readReceiptAt = maxNullable(local.readReceiptAt, remote.readReceiptAt); // per-field LWW
local.dismissedAt = maxNullable(local.dismissedAt, remote.dismissedAt);
}
Known limitation: the whole-Map serializer means a tab's write replaces the full key; with N tabs committing concurrently, whole-Map last-writer-wins can clobber a concurrent per-entity edit before
mergeLattice(which only runs on the receiving side after a storage event) reconciles it. For strict multi-tab durability, enable the optionaluseTabLeadersingle-writer path.

Priority + policy decides toast-vs-inbox entirely inside registry.shouldToast(n): 'always'→toast;
'never'→inbox-only; 'by-priority'→n.priority >= toastFloor (default high). Every notification
lands in the inbox (durable Deque); only shouldToast ones also enter the surfacing PriorityQueue.
critical renders type='foreground' (assertive aria-live) and interrupts the lowest visible toast.

9. SSR, testing, tree-shaking
SSR. core/realtime imports nothing from Vue and touches WebSocket/BroadcastChannel/timers only
after connect(). useRealtime returns ssrNoopRealtime() when !isClient. useStorage defers with
initOnMounted. useSharedRealtime (createSharedComposable) returns a fresh raw instance on the
server. The unread badge renders only after onMounted. <Toaster> lives under <ClientOnly>.
